Sainz admits Singapore was a breakthrough for McLaren
Carlos Sainz believes McLaren made great strides with the car In Singapore after the team recorded their best qualifying result of the season. Sainz came through in seventh while his teammate Lando Norris reached eighth. To underline just how much better the team were in qualifying in Austin, they were lapping just 0.9% behind the fastest team.
